WOLF RUGGED VPX3U-XAVIER SINGLE BOARD COMPUTER

Announcement posted by Metromatics 16 Apr 2020

WOLF Advanced Technology - designers, developers and manufacturers of Rugged Video Graphics Modules for capture, process, display and AI inference show case the VPX34-Xavier-SB

The Wolf VPX34-Xavier-SBC can be employed in numerous applications, including Video processing, graphics/conversion, radar processing.  Also, in industries where Autonomy is required such as avionics, automotive, drones, military and mining, to name just a few in this ever-expanding field. The VPX3U-Xavier Single board computer is used in C4ISR - (Command, Control, Communication, Computers, Intelligence, Surveillance, and Reconnaissance) as well as Artificial Intelligence one of the fastest growing industries of the future.

Key Features of this single board computer include:

NVIDIA Volta GPU with 512 CUDA cores and 64 Tensor cores

1.4 TFLOPS FP32, 22.6 DL TOPS 8-bit

NVIDIA Carmel ARM64 CPU with 8 cores, 2.26 GHz

16 GB LPDDR4 256-bit memory with up to 137 GB/s

Outputs

          3 DisplayPort

          2 CVBS

          2 SDI

          1 GigE 

Storage

          32 GB SSD

          256GB SSD (Option)

          1TB SSD (Option

2 NVENC Engines (H.264/H.265)

2 NVDEC Engines (H.264/H.265

Module power: 30-50W.

available in COTS and MCOTS

Options include - 10GigE, capture of SDI, CVBS, ARINC 818, CoaXPress, and other video signal requirements

 High Level of Ruggedisation 

All of WOLF’s modules are designed and manufactured specifically for use in the harsh environments encountered in military and aerospace applications. They have been designed to pass MIL-STD-810 and DO-160 environmental tests. They have been manufactured to IPC-A-610 CLASS 3 and IPC 6012 CLASS 3 for high reliability electronic products. They are compliant with IPC J-STD-001 soldering standards.

  About WOLF

WOLF Advanced Technology designs and manufactures rugged VPX, XMC, and MXM/MXC modules for video capture, process, display, and AI inference. Solutions are designed to operate in harsh aerospace and defence environments.
